Lyrics

[Verse]

Sunsets over cotton fields of gold,

Mama's voice, a story often told.

Daddy's guitar pluckin' soft and slow,

Summer nights where fireflies glow.

[Verse 2]

Porch swings swayin', creakin' in the breeze,

Laughter echoing through the tall pine trees.

Barefoot walks along a dusty road,

Dreams are carried by the songs we've sowed.

[Chorus]

Isn't Alabama home, wherever you may roam?

Where the heartstrings tie you back, to places that you know.

Isn't Alabama home when the days have lost their glow?

Just a memory away, in the fields where we would grow.

[Verse 3]

Church bells ringin' on a Sunday morn,

Fields of clover where our love was born.

Grandpa's stories 'bout the days gone by,

Underneath the southern sky.

[Verse 4]

Hometown diner serves a piece of pie,

Neighbors wave as we pass on by.

The simple life, the stories that we share,

In a place beyond compare.
